Understanding Network Resilience
Network resilience refers to the ability of a network to continue functioning amid failures or disruptions. By building resilience into network design, enterprises can minimize downtime and maintain service quality.
Components of a Resilient Network
Key components of a resilient network include redundancy, scalability, and security. Organizations need to ensure that their networks can handle increased traffic while providing secure connections.
Cloud Solutions and Network Resilience
Leveraging cloud solutions can enhance network resilience. By distributing resources across multiple locations, businesses can balance workloads and reduce the risk of outages.
Best Practices for Network Architecture
Implementing best practices such as regular assessments, security audits, and employee training can further enhance network resilience. A proactive approach helps identify weaknesses before they lead to significant issues.
